Exploring France: A Journey Through Europe‘s Enchanting Heart15
France, a land of unparalleled charm and cultural heritage, beckons travelers from all corners of the world. Nestled in the heart of Europe, this captivating country offers a kaleidoscope of experiences, from the bustling streets of Paris to the sun-kissed beaches of the Côte d'Azur.
Paris: The City of Lights
No visit to France is complete without a pilgrimage to Paris, the City of Lights. This cosmopolitan metropolis is renowned for its iconic landmarks, world-class museums, and vibrant nightlife. Stroll down the Champs-Élysées, ascend the Eiffel Tower, and lose yourself in the labyrinthine streets of the Latin Quarter.
Versailles: A Royal Palace Fit for Kings
Just outside Paris lies the magnificent Palace of Versailles, a testament to the grandeur of the French monarchy. Wander through its opulent halls, admire the stunning gardens, and witness the splendor that once defined the French court.
The Loire Valley: A Tapestry of Castles and Vineyards
Venture west to the Loire Valley, a region dotted with enchanting castles and rolling vineyards. Visit the Château de Chambord, a marvel of Renaissance architecture, and sip on world-renowned wines in the picturesque villages of Sancerre and Bourgueil.
Mont-Saint-Michel: A Medieval Fortress Built on a Rock
Perched on a rocky island off the coast of Normandy, Mont-Saint-Michel is a UNESCO World Heritage Site that has captivated generations. Explore its medieval streets, climb to the abbey at its summit, and witness the breathtaking views of the Normandy coastline.
Étretat: Dramatic Cliffs and Impressionist Art
Travel north to Étretat, a seaside town immortalized by the paintings of Monet. Hike along the towering cliffs, marvel at the natural arches, and soak up the artistic ambiance that once inspired the Impressionist masters.
The French Riviera: Coastal Paradise
On the southeastern coast, the French Riviera beckons with its azure waters, sandy beaches, and glamorous resorts. Bask in the sun on the beaches of Nice and Cannes, explore the medieval villages of Eze and Saint-Paul-de-Vence, and soak in the vibrant atmosphere of this iconic coastline.
Provence: Lavender Fields and Quaint Villages
Provence, renowned for its picturesque landscapes and fragrant lavender fields, offers a tranquil retreat. Visit the ancient Roman ruins of Arles, wander through the cobblestone streets of Avignon, and immerse yourself in the vibrant culture of this southern region.
The Alps: Majestic Mountains and Alpine Adventure
In the southeastern corner of France, the majestic Alps beckon with their soaring peaks and pristine lakes. Hike through the valleys of Chamonix, ski down the slopes of Courchevel, and witness the breathtaking beauty of the Mont Blanc, the highest mountain in Europe.
Normandy: History and D-Day Beaches
Normandy, steeped in both natural beauty and historical significance, is the site of the D-Day landings during World War II. Visit the iconic beaches of Omaha and Utah, explore the historic cities of Caen and Rouen, and pay homage to the fallen at the American Cemetery of Colleville-sur-Mer.
Burgundy: A Culinary and Cultural Gem
In eastern France, the Burgundy region is renowned for its fine wines and medieval history. Explore the vineyards of Chablis and Beaune, visit the ancient city of Dijon, and indulge in the culinary delights of this gastronomic paradise.
Lyon: A Culinary Capital
Lyon, located in southeastern France, is considered the culinary capital of France. Sample traditional Lyonnais dishes, wander through the vibrant markets of Les Halles de Lyon, and marvel at the architectural wonders of Vieux Lyon, the historic old town.
Strasbourg: A Gateway to the East
In the northeast of France, Strasbourg sits at the crossroads of Europe. Admire the Gothic cathedral, explore the charming Petite France district, and witness the unique blend of French and German cultures in this historic city.
Bordeaux: A Wine and Architectural Marvel
Bordeaux, the "Wine Capital of the World," is a city of elegance and architectural splendor. Visit the world-famous vineyards of the Médoc, explore the historic center, and marvel at the grandeur of the Place de la Bourse.
The Basque Country: A Melting Pot of Cultures
In the southwestern corner of France, the Basque Country is a vibrant region with a unique cultural identity. Explore the charming villages of Biarritz and Saint-Jean-de-Luz, witness the traditional Basque pelota games, and savor the flavors of Basque cuisine.
Corsica: A Mediterranean Paradise
Off the coast of France, Corsica is a rugged and beautiful island with stunning beaches, towering mountains, and a rich cultural heritage. Hike through the Parc National Régional de Corse, visit the historic citadel of Bonifacio, and enjoy the pristine waters of the Mediterranean Sea.
